WW2 era - Comic Postcard - That ll stop your careless talk
The Caption is P raps that ll stop your careless talk!. Three little kids cover-up a younger toddlers mouth with a spotty hankerchief. In reference to the Government campaign to prevent wartime secrets being surreptitiously passed to the enemy through loose lips. Cute Kids WW2 Wartime humour Date: 1942

EDITORS COMMENTS
"That'll Stop Your Careless Talk! (Praps, 1942) - In this charming and humorous WW2-era comic postcard, three little kids are seen covering up the mouth of a younger toddler with a spotty hankie. The image is a playful reference to the government campaign encouraging citizens to be vigilant about sharing sensitive information with the enemy. The caption "That'll Stop Your Careless Talk!" adds a light-hearted touch to the serious message. The sweet and innocent scene of the children, with the older kids attempting to keep their younger sibling quiet, is reminiscent of the innocence and resilience of children during wartime. The use of caricature and exaggerated expressions adds to the amusing nature of the image. The postcard was published in 1942 and is the work of artist Madge Williams. The image of the gagged boy with a hoop around his head, confronting the viewer, adds an element of surprise and humor to the design. This unique and entertaining postcard is a delightful reminder of the wartime spirit and the creative ways in which people found joy and levity during difficult times."
